PrintGooey Reese’s Cheesecake Cookies
If you’re a peanut butter and chocolate lover, then you’ve just found your dream cookie! These Gooey Reese’s Cheesecake Cookies combine the rich, creamy flavor of cheesecake with the indulgent sweetness of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ups, Reese’s Pieces, and white chocolate chips. Each bite of these cookies is a perfect balance of gooey, chewy, and crunchy textures, delivering an irresistible combination of flavors that will leave you craving more. These cookies are perfect for any occasion, whether you’re baking for a special event or just want to treat yourself. Here’s how to make these decadent delights!
- Total Time: 32 minutes
Ingredients
Dry Ingredients:
- 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- ½ teaspoon baking soda
- ½ te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on salt
Wet Ingredients:
- 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
- ½ cup granulated sugar
- ½ cup packed brown sugar
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 4 oz cream cheese, softened
Add-ins:
- 1 cup mini Reese’s Pieces
- ½ cup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ups, chopped
- ½ cup white chocolate chips
For Drizzling:
- ½ cup semi-sweet chocolate chips, melted
Instructions
1️⃣ Preheat the Oven
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
2️⃣ Prepare Dry Ingredients
In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.
3️⃣ Cream the Wet Ingredients
In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the egg and vanilla extract until combined. Add the softened cream cheese and mix until smooth and fully incorporated.
4️⃣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
5️⃣ Add the Mix-ins
Gently fold in the mini Reese’s Pieces, chopped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ups, and white chocolate chips.
6️⃣ Shape the Cookies
Scoop about 2 tablespoons of dough per cookie onto the prepared baking sheet, slightly flattening each one.
7️⃣ Bake the Cookies
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den. Allow cookies to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
8️⃣ Drizzle with Chocolate
Once the cookies are cooled, drizzle the melted semi-sweet chocolate chips over the top for that extra touch of chocolatey goodness.
Notes
- Chill the Dough: For a thicker cookie with a chewier texture, refrigerate the dough for 30 minutes before baking.
- Storage: Store leftover c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week, or freeze them for longer freshness.
- Substitutions: Feel free to use milk chocolate chips or dark chocolate chips instead of white chocolate for a different flavor profile.
